Historical & Cultural Background

The name Bray has roots in both English and Irish cultures. In English, it is often associated with geographical features, indicating a broad or wide area. In Ireland, it is linked to the Gaelic surname Brágh, which signifies bravery. The name has been used in various forms throughout history, reflecting regional variations.

U.S. Historical Usage

The name Bray was first seen in the United States in 1970. Bray has ranked as high as #1314 nationally, which occurred in 2024, and has been most popular in Texas, and Tennessee. In the past 5 years the name Bray has been trending up compared to the previous 5 years.
